[Ayin English] Sarah Joseph, like many South Sudanese in Juba and those residing across the border in neighbouring Sudan, was stunned. Few South Sudanese thought the war would break out in Sudan's capital, Khartoum, and even fewer predicted this would occur so abruptly on 15 April.
